Proper Equipment
The average mechanic does not generally have access to the full range of tools that are required to work on every vehicle. The biggest issue is that general mechanics specialize in a wide range of vehicles. Dealerships work on their brand of vehicles and have the exact tools needed for every job. Another important factor is parts—dealers use original manufacturer parts, which are the factory-made parts for your vehicle. This means your vehicle will be repaired and maintained with the highest-quality parts available, not some aftermarket parts that might only get the job done for a while.
Trained Technicians
The staff at your dealership consists of technicians who must go through both general mechanics’ training, as well as dealer-specific training to ensure they know exactly how to work on that brand of vehicle. This ensures that when they work on your vehicle, they know where every piece is supposed to go and will quickly make any repairs or spot any potential problems. Dealerships are also the first—and sometimes only—shops to receive recall or change notices. This means if a recall is announced and you have your vehicle serviced at the dealer, they will inform you and make the repair.
